A fun wine with an intriguing label - exposing flavour and truth it reads. Dolcetto and Lagrein seeing no oak. Hello Saturday BBQ!
A blend 95/5 only seeing stainless steel for six months. Get fresher.
Whiffs of peppered steak, tilled black earth and juicy red berries, its soft through the mouth. There's good weight and the fruit fills out accordingly before dried herbs rise up late. A long peppery finish hangs and pleads for some meat to hold its hand. Sausages or steak or both plus a BBQ for the win. A wine you can easily chill to make it even more versitile during the warmer months.
Drink now to three years.
88/100
